Borderlands 4 has caught fire among the gaming community, with many deeming it a lackluster entry in the franchise. Players are voicing concerns over the forgettable story and generic characters, arguing that the game's identity has shifted vastly from previous installments.

The Shift in Identity

Players have taken to forums to express disappointment over Borderlands 4's narrative and gameplay. One player stated, "The story is just forgettable, characters are generic." This sentiment reflects a general dissatisfaction with the new direction taken by Gearbox Software.

Open World Design Concerns

Several comments raise issues with the gameโ€™s open-world design. One comment reads, "The open world choice meant we got the worst of everything in exchange for it." Players miss the more engaging, compact designs of previous games, feeling that vast travel distances detract from engagement. In addition, the sense of adventure appears diminished in the sprawling environments.

A Journey Through Time's Echoes

Interestingly, this situation echoes the fate of the original Final Fantasy XIV, which was launched to disappointment in 2010. Similar to Borderlands 4, it faced backlash over its mechanics and storytelling. However, Square Enix recognized the missteps and initiated a major overhaul that ultimately transformed it into Final Fantasy XIV: A Realm Reborn, now one of the most successful MMORPGs. This instance highlights the game industry's ever-present potential for redemption: even from the ashes of dissatisfaction can arise something beloved and engaging.
